This eye defect is known as Presbyopia. Key Points. Presbyopia is the gradual loss of your eyes' ability to focus on nearby objects. Presbyopia usually becomes noticeable in the early to mid-40s and continues to worsen until around age 65.

WebIn middle age, the lens of the eye becomes less flexible and less able to thicken and thus less able to focus on nearby objects, a condition called presbyopia .
